How Our Kitchen Water Damage Restoration Process Works

We understand that water damage can be overwhelming, but our team is here to make the process as smooth as possible. Our expert technicians will assess the damage, identify the source, and develop a customized plan to restore your kitchen to its original condition.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Moisture detection using advanced equipment to identify hidden water sources. We’ll contain the area to prevent further damage and protect your belongings.

Step 2: Water Removal and Extraction

Fast and efficient water removal using specialized equipment to extract water from the affected area. We’ll remove any standing water and dry the area thoroughly.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Advanced drying equipment to remove excess moisture and humidity. We’ll use dehumidifiers to prevent further damage and promote a healthy environment.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ection

Thorough cleaning of the affected area to remove any bacteria, mold, or mildew. We’ll disinfect the area to prevent future growth and ensure your kitchen is safe and healthy.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Restoration

Final inspection to ensure the area is dry and free from any damage. We’ll restore your kitchen to its original condition, and you’ll be back to normal in no time.

Warning Signs You Need Kitchen Water Damage Restoration

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ore these warning signs, and act quickly to prevent further damage.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ors that linger even after cleaning. This could be a sign of hidden moisture and mold growth.

Warped or Discolored Flooring

Warped or discolored flooring that’s no longer stable or safe to walk on. This could be a sign of water damage that’s been ignored for too long.

Leaking Appliances or Fixtures

Leaking appliances or fixtures that are causing water damage and damage to surrounding areas. This could be a sign of a more serious issue that needs to be addressed.

Visible Water Stains or Damage

Visible water stains or damage that’s affecting the walls, ceilings, or floors. This could be a sign of water damage that’s been ignored for too long.

Unpleasant Smells or Bacterial Growth

Unpleasant smells or bacterial growth that’s affecting the air quality and your health. This could be a sign of hidden moisture and mold growth.

Increased Humidity or Moisture

Increased humidity or moisture that’s affecting the environment and promoting mold growth. This could be a sign of hidden water damage that needs to be addressed.

Kitchen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ill from the sink Yes No You can clean up the spill and dry the area yourself.
Large water spill from a burst pipe No Yes You need professional equipment and expertise to contain and dry the area.
Visible water stains or damage No Yes You need to assess and address the damage quickly to prevent further damage.
Unpleasant smells or bacterial growth No Yes You need to address the hidden moisture and mold growth to prevent health risks.
Warped or discolored flooring No Yes You need to assess and address the damage quickly to prevent further damage.
Increased humidity or moisture No Yes You need to address the hidden water damage to prevent further damage and promote a healthy environment.
